Developing a successful Android app requires a well-thought-out strategy, a talented development team, and a commitment to delivering user value. Here are the key steps an Android app development company should follow to develop a successful app:

  1. Market Research and Idea Validation: Before starting development, it's essential to conduct thorough market research to identify user needs, market trends, and potential competitors. Validate your app idea to ensure there's demand for it.

  2. Define Clear Objectives and Goals: Clearly define the objectives and goals of the app. Understand what problem your app will solve or what value it will provide users. These objectives will guide the development process.

  3. User-Centered Design: Develop a user-centered design that provides an intuitive and enjoyable user experience. Consider user personas, wireframes, and prototypes to refine the app's design before development begins.

  4. Select the Right Technology Stack: Choose the appropriate technology stack for Android app development. It includes selecting the programming language (Java or Kotlin), android app development frameworks, and tools that align with your project's requirements.

  5. Agile Development Process: Adopt an agile development methodology to ensure flexibility and responsiveness to changing requirements. Break the project into smaller, manageable sprints, allowing regular testing and iterations.

  6. Quality Assurance and Testing: Implement rigorous quality assurance and testing processes throughout the development cycle. Conduct functional, usability, and performance testing to identify and fix issues promptly.

  7. Optimize for Performance: Ensure the app is optimized for performance and speed. Pay attention to factors like load times, responsiveness, and efficient use of device resources to provide a smooth user experience.

  8. Security and Data Protection: Prioritize security and data protection. Implement encryption, authentication, and authorization mechanisms to safeguard user data and maintain user trust.

  9. Cross-Device and OS Compatibility: Ensure the app is compatible with Android devices and versions. Ensures that your app reaches a broader audience and minimizes compatibility issues.

  10. Scalability and Future-Proofing: Build the app with scalability in mind, allowing it to grow and adapt to changing requirements. Consider future updates, new features, and platform changes when designing the architecture.

  11. User Feedback and Iteration: Encourage user feedback and use it to drive improvements. Continuously iterate on the app based on user suggestions and data analytics to enhance user satisfaction.

  12. App Store Optimization (ASO): Develop a robust ASO strategy to maximize your app's visibility on the Google Play Store. Optimize app titles, descriptions, keywords, and visuals to attract more downloads.

  13. Marketing and Promotion: Plan and execute a marketing strategy to promote your app. Utilize social media, online advertising, content marketing, and other channels to reach your target audience.

  14. Launch and Post-launch Support: Launch the app on the Google Play Store and closely monitor its performance. Provide post-launch support, addressing issues, releasing updates, and adding new features as needed.

  15. User Engagement and Retention: Focus on engagement and retention strategies to keep users returning to your app. Push notifications, in-app messaging, and personalized content help maintain user interest.

  16. Analytics and Data-driven Decisions: Implement tools to gather user data and insights. Use this data to make informed decisions about app improvements and updates.

  17. Community Building: Foster a community around your app, encouraging user interaction, feedback, and loyalty. Engaged users can become advocates for your app.

  18. Monetization Strategy: If your app is intended to generate revenue, develop a clear monetization strategy. Options include in-app purchases, subscriptions, ads, or a combination.

  19. Legal and Compliance: Ensure that your app complies with all relevant legal and regulatory requirements, including data privacy laws and terms of service agreements.

  20. Continuous Improvement: The development process doesn't end with the initial release. Continuously improve your app by staying updated with technology trends and user preferences.

Developing a successful Android app is an ongoing process that requires dedication and a commitment to delivering user value. By following these steps and continually striving for excellence, an Android app development company can increase the chances of creating a successful and widely adopted app.
